Rate this post

Rozszerzenie pliku „INI-DIST”: Co warto wiedzieć?

W dobie intensywnego rozwoju technologii i nieskończonych możliwości, każdy programista, administrator systemów czy entuzjasta komputerowy musi zaznajomić się z różnorodnymi typami plików, które są nieodłącznym elementem codziennej pracy z oprogramowaniem. Jednym z mniej znanych, a jednocześnie niezwykle interesujących rozszerzeń jest plik „INI-DIST”. Choć może nie cieszy się on taką popularnością jak pliki .txt czy .xml, pełni istotną rolę w wielu aplikacjach. W tym artykule przyjrzymy się bliżej plikom z rozszerzeniem INI-DIST, ich funkcji, zastosowaniu oraz temu, jak mogą one ułatwić zarządzanie konfiguracją w różnych środowiskach. Czytaj dalej, aby dowiedzieć się więcej o tym tajemniczym rozszerzeniu i odkryć jego potencjał!

Rozszerzenie INI-DIST: Co to jest i jakie ma zastosowania w programowaniu

Rozszerzenie INI-DIST odnosi się do plików konfiguracyjnych, które są szeroko stosowane w programowaniu aplikacji, szczególnie w środowiskach Windows. Pliki te są używane do przechowywania ustawień oraz informacji konfiguracyjnych w formacie tekstowym, co ułatwia ich edycję i zarządzanie. Ich popularność wynika z prostoty oraz czytelności, co czyni je idealnym wyborem dla programistów.

W zastosowaniach programistycznych, rozszerzenie INI-DIST może być wykorzystane w różnych kontekstach, oto niektóre z nich:

  • Konfiguracja aplikacji: Programiści mogą łatwo wczytywać i modyfikować opcje konfiguracji swoich aplikacji, co umożliwia personalizację bez potrzeby rekompilacji kodu.
  • Ustawienia systemowe: Pliki INI-DIST mogą służyć do przechowywania ustawień systemowych, dzięki czemu aplikacje mogą dostosowywać swoje zachowanie w zależności od preferencji użytkownika.
  • Przechowywanie danych: Dzięki swojej prostocie, format INI-DIST idealnie nadaje się do przechowywania niewielkich zbiorów danych, które nie wymagają zaawansowanych struktur.

Poniższa tabela ilustruje różnice między tradycyjnymi plikami INI a rozszerzeniem INI-DIST:

CechaINIINI-DIST
FormatZwykły tekstZwykły tekst z dodatkowymi możliwościami
Możliwość edycjiTakTak, z ułatwieniem dla użytkowników
Wsparcie dla aplikacjiOgraniczoneSzersze zakresy zastosowań

Warto zauważyć, że rozszerzenie INI-DIST może być również wykorzystywane w połączeniu z innymi technologiami, takimi jak bazy danych, co pozwala na lepsze zarządzanie danymi aplikacji. W miarę jak rozwija się technologia i rośnie potrzeba elastyczności w konfigurowaniu aplikacji, pliki INI-DIST zyskują na znaczeniu, oferując programistom nowe możliwości w zakresie zarządzania ustawieniami i danymi.

Jak skutecznie wykorzystać pliki INI-DIST w konfiguracji aplikacji

Pliki INI-DIST stanowią niezwykle użyteczne narzędzie w procesie konfiguracji aplikacji, umożliwiając łatwe zarządzanie ustawieniami w sposób przejrzysty i zorganizowany. Aby efektywnie wykorzystać te pliki, warto zwrócić uwagę na kilka kluczowych aspektów:

  • Struktura pliku: Pliki INI-DIST są zbudowane z sekcji i kluczy, co pozwala na łatwe segregowanie różnych ustawień. Każda sekcja zaczyna się od nazwy otoczonej nawiasami kwadratowymi, a klucze są parą klucz-wartość, co ułatwia interpretację danych.
  • Podział na sekcje: Warto zorganizować ustawienia w logiczne grupy. Na przykład, sekcja [Database] może zawierać informacje o połączeniu z bazą danych, natomiast [UserSettings] będzie dotyczyć preferencji użytkownika.
  • Wartości domyślne: Korzystanie z wartości domyślnych w pliku INI-DIST pozwala na automatyczne wypełnienie brakujących danych w aplikacji. Dzięki temu, nawet jeśli użytkownik nie wprowadzi wszystkich ustawień, aplikacja będzie mogła działać poprawnie.
  • Dokumentacja: Zawsze warto dołączyć do pliku krótki opis poszczególnych sekcji i kluczy, aby inni deweloperzy mogli łatwiej zrozumieć strukturę i cel danej konfiguracji. Elementy komentujące w plikach INI rozpoczynają się od ; .

W procesie wdrażania plików INI-DIST, zalecane jest również zastosowanie kilku dobrych praktyk:

  • Tylko istotne informacje: Pliki INI powinny zawierać wyłącznie istotne dla aplikacji informacje. Unikaj nadmiaru danych, aby nie zaśmiecać konfiguracji.
  • Testowanie: Po dokonaniu zmian w pliku, zawsze warto przetestować aplikację, aby upewnić się, że wszystkie ustawienia działają poprawnie i są zgodne z zamierzeniami.
  • Aktualizacje: Regularnie aktualizuj pliki INI-DIST zgodnie z wprowadzanymi zmianami w kodzie aplikacji czy nowych funkcjonalnościach, aby pozostały zgodne z bieżącymi wymaganiami.

Przykładowa struktura pliku INI-DIST może wyglądać następująco:

Nazwa sekcjiKluczWartość
[Database]Hostlocalhost
[Database]Usernameroot
[UserSettings]Languagepl
[UserSettings]Themedefault

Stosowanie plików INI-DIST w konfiguracji aplikacji znacząco upraszcza zarządzanie ustawieniami, a ich elastyczność i prostota sprawiają, że są one doskonałym rozwiązaniem dla wielu projektów. Dzięki nim można wprowadzić porządek i przejrzystość w każdym etapie życia aplikacji.

Problemy i wyzwania związane z formatem INI-DIST oraz ich rozwiązania

Format INI-DIST, mimo swojej prostoty i funkcjonalności, zmaga się z wieloma problemami oraz wyzwaniami. Oto niektóre z nich:

  • Niska wymienność danych – Wielu użytkowników ma trudności z przenoszeniem danych między różnymi systemami, z powodu braku uniwersalnych konwencji w formatowaniu plików INI-DIST.
  • Brak wsparcia dla struktur zagnieżdżonych – INI-DIST nie obsługuje złożonych struktur danych, co ogranicza możliwość skomplikowanego konfigurowania aplikacji.
  • Problemy z komentowaniem – W formacie często występuje problem z dodawaniem komentarzy, co może prowadzić do niejednoznaczności i trudności w dokumentowaniu konfiguracji.
  • Ograniczenia w typach danych – Format ten nie wspiera bardziej zaawansowanych typów danych, co ogranicza jego funkcjonalność w nowoczesnych aplikacjach.

Aby zminimalizować te problemy, można zastosować następujące rozwiązania:

  • Ustandaryzowanie formatów – Wprowadzenie wspólnych standardów dla zapisu i odczytu plików INI-DIST mogłoby znacząco ułatwić wymianę danych między różnymi systemami.
  • Rozszerzenie składni – Dostosowanie formatu do obsługi złożonych struktur zagnieżdżonych może znacznie zwiększyć jego uniwersalność i funkcjonalność.
  • Wprowadzenie lepszego systemu komentowania – Może to uwolnić użytkowników od nieporozumień, umożliwiając łatwiejsze zrozumienie i dokumentowanie plików konfiguracyjnych.
  • Rozszerzenie obsługiwanych typów danych – Dodanie wsparcia dla różnych typów danych pozwoli na lepsze wykorzystanie tego formatu w nowoczesnych aplikacjach.
ProblemPotencjalne rozwiązanie
Niska wymienność danychUstandaryzowanie formatów
Brak wsparcia dla struktur zagnieżdżonychRozszerzenie składni
Problemy z komentowaniemWprowadzenie lepszego systemu komentowania
Ograniczenia w typach danychRozszerzenie obsługiwanych typów danych

W zakończeniu tego artykułu, warto podkreślić, że plik INI-DIST, z jego unikalną strukturą i szerokim zastosowaniem, staje się coraz bardziej popularnym narzędziem w świecie programowania oraz konfiguracji oprogramowania. Dzięki swojej prostocie i elastyczności, pliki INI-DIST oferują programistom efektywny sposób na zarządzanie ustawieniami i parametrami aplikacji.

Nie możemy zapominać, że ich znaczenie nie ogranicza się tylko do sfery technicznej. W dobie szybkiego rozwoju technologii, umiejętność pracy z różnorodnymi formatami plików, w tym INI-DIST, może okazać się kluczowa dla przyszłych programistów i inżynierów. W miarę jak nasze środowisko IT staje się coraz bardziej złożone, warto inwestować czas w naukę i zrozumienie tych narzędzi, aby skuteczniej dostosowywać się do zmieniających się potrzeb rynku.

Zachęcamy do dalszego zgłębiania tematu i eksperymentowania z plikami INI-DIST w codziennej pracy. Dzięki temu zyskacie nie tylko nową wiedzę, ale także umiejętności, które będą nieocenione w Waszej karierze. Dziękujemy za lekturę i zapraszamy do śledzenia naszych kolejnych artykułów, w których będziemy omawiać inne fascynujące aspekty świata technologii!